The sewage disposal system shall comply with the on site sewage Standards of San Joaquin County <br /> prior to issuance of building permits. A percolation test and a sewage disposal area, as determined by <br /> the percolation test, are required prior to the Environmental Health Department approval. A permit <br /> for the percolation tests must be obtained from the Environmental Health Department(San Joaquin <br /> County Development Title, Section 9-1110.3, 9-1110.4(c),and 9-1110.5). <br /> NOTE: The applicant should consider relocating the proposed well to allow the septic system to be <br /> constructed closer to the proposed office. <br /> A./B. State on revised site plans the maximum number of employees and customers the sewage disposal <br /> system is being designed for. In addition, show on revised plans that the leach field area will be <br /> barricaded so it cannot be driven over, parked on,or used as a storage area. This leach field area must <br /> be used for that specific purpose only,and it cannot contain any underground utility lines(San <br /> Joaquin County Development Title, Section 9-1110.4(c)(5)). In addition,the revised site plan shall <br /> incorporate the 100% designed sewage disposal replacement area. <br /> `�. Construction of individual sewage-disposal-system(s)under permit and inspection by the <br /> Environmental Health Department is required at the time of development based on the percolation <br /> test findings (San Joaquin County Development Title, Section 9-1110.3 &9-1110.4). <br /> v✓D. Construct water well under permit and inspection of the Environmental Health Department prior to <br /> occupancy. Should the number of non-resident individuals exceed 24 for at least 60 days per year,or <br /> the number of service connections exceed four, a yearly permit to operate a public water system will <br /> be required by the Environmental Health Department(San Joaquin County Development Title, <br /> Section 9-1120.2 and 9-1115.9.). <br /> The supplier must possess adequate financial, managerial, and technical capability to assure delivery <br /> of pure, wholesome, and potable drinking water in accordance with San Joaquin County Development <br /> Title, Sections 9-1120.2 and 9-1115.9 and C.C.R., Title 22, and Health and Safety Code, Section <br /> 116525 through 116570. <br /> a7os <br /> C MH:cf <br />
